Tour description

Together we will discover why Split is a hidden gem of the Mediterranean, from Diocletian’s times to nowadays – DISCOVER why everybody talks about Croatia! 

 
Our journey will start in 295 A.D., as you see you are visiting a 1700-year-old city, and wondering how it all happen. How the palace became the second-largest city in Croatia? And how is life in Croatia today? 

This free tour follows the footsteps of Diocletian, a local boy who left a huge impact on the Roman Empire. His palace, today a UNESCO World Heritage Site, holds historical sights, secrets, and stories that will come to life on this tour. 

 

This tour covers the most important Split’s historical events like:

  • Diocletian's comeback
  • Demolition of Salona 
  • Beginning of Settlement of the Palace
  • The transformation from pagan to Christian buildings

 

We will see different areas of the complex, such as the cellars and monumental Peristyle courtyard. Look at the emperor's private observatory and see the Cathedral of Saint Domnius, originally built as Diocletian's Mausoleum. Discover the site of the Temple of Jupiter and Baptistery, and the original Bronze Gate, Silver Gate, Golden Gate, and Iron Gate that provided access to the city. Discover a refuge for the noblewomen of Split at the Benedictine Monastery of St. Arnir, admire the original 15th-century Town Hall, and marvel at the Baroque monuments of Fruit Square (Voćni trg).
